#!/bin/bash
# =============================================================================
# Sub2API Docker Deployment Preparation Script
# =============================================================================
# This script prepares deployment files for Sub2API:
# - Downloads docker-compose.local.yml and .env.example
# - Generates secure secrets (JWT_SECRET, T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Y, POSTGRES_PASSWORD)
# - Creates necessary data directories
#
# After running this script, you can start services with:
# docker-compose -f docker-compose.local.yml up -d
# =============================================================================
set -e
# Colors for output
RED='\033[0;31m'
GREEN='\033[0;32m'
YELLOW='\033[1;33m'
BLUE='\033[0;34m'
NC='\033[0m' # No Color
# GitHub raw content base URL
GITHUB_RAW_URL="https://raw.githubusercontent.com/Wei-Shaw/sub2api/main/deploy"
# Print colored message
print_info() {
echo -e "${BLUE}[INFO]${NC} $1"
}
print_success() {
echo -e "${GREEN}[SUCCESS]${NC} $1"
}
print_warning() {
echo -e "${YELLOW}[WARNING]${NC} $1"
}
print_error() {
echo -e "${RED}[ERROR]${NC} $1"
}
# Generate random secret
generate_secret() {
openssl rand -hex 32
}
# Check if command exists
command_exists() {
command -v "$1" >/dev/null 2>&1
}
# Main installation function
main() {
echo ""
echo "=========================================="
echo " Sub2API Deployment Preparation"
echo "=========================================="
echo ""
# Check if openssl is available
if ! command_exists openssl; then
print_error "openssl is not installed. Please install openssl first."
exit 1
fi
# Check if deployment already exists
if [ -f "docker-compose.local.yml" ] && [ -f ".env" ]; then
print_warning "Deployment files already exist in current directory."
read -p "Overwrite existing files? (y/N): " -r
echo
if [[ ! $REPLY =~ ^[Yy]$ ]]; then
print_info "Cancelled."
exit 0
fi
fi
# Download docker-compose.local.yml
print_info "Downloading docker-compose.local.yml..."
if command_exists curl; then
curl -sSL "${GITHUB_RAW_URL}/docker-compose.local.yml" -o docker-compose.local.yml
elif command_exists wget; then
wget -q "${GITHUB_RAW_URL}/docker-compose.local.yml" -O docker-compose.local.yml
else
print_error "Neither curl nor wget is installed. Please install one of them."
exit 1
fi
print_success "Downloaded docker-compose.local.yml"
# Download .env.example
print_info "Downloading .env.example..."
if command_exists curl; then
curl -sSL "${GITHUB_RAW_URL}/.env.example" -o .env.example
else
wget -q "${GITHUB_RAW_URL}/.env.example" -O .env.example
fi
print_success "Downloaded .env.example"
# Generate .env file with auto-generated secrets
print_info "Generating secure secrets..."
echo ""
# Generate secrets
JWT_SECRET=$(generate_secret)
T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Y=$(generate_secret)
POSTGRES_PASSWORD=$(generate_secret)
# Create .env from .env.example
cp .env.example .env
# Update .env with generated secrets (cross-platform compatible)
if sed --version >/dev/null 2>&1; then
# GNU sed (Linux)
sed -i "s/^JWT_SECRET=.*/JWT_SECRET=${JWT_SECRET}/" .env
sed -i "s/^T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Y=.*/T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Y=${T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Y}/" .env
sed -i "s/^POSTGRES_PASSWORD=.*/POSTGRES_PASSWORD=${POSTGRES_PASSWORD}/" .env
else
# BSD sed (macOS)
sed -i '' "s/^JWT_SECRET=.*/JWT_SECRET=${JWT_SECRET}/" .env
sed -i '' "s/^T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Y=.*/T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Y=${T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Y}/" .env
sed -i '' "s/^POSTGRES_PASSWORD=.*/POSTGRES_PASSWORD=${POSTGRES_PASSWORD}/" .env
fi
# Create data directories
print_info "Creating data directories..."
mkdir -p data postgres_data redis_data
print_success "Created data directories"
# Set secure permissions for .env file (readable/writable only by owner)
chmod 600 .env
echo ""
# Display completion message
echo "=========================================="
echo " Preparation Complete!"
echo "=========================================="
echo ""
echo "Generated secure credentials:"
echo " POSTGRES_PASSWORD: ${POSTGRES_PASSWORD}"
echo " JWT_SECRET: ${JWT_SECRET}"
echo " T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Y: ${TOTP_ENCRYPTION_KEY}"
echo ""
print_warning "These credentials have been saved to .env file."
print_warning "Please keep them secure and do not share publicly!"
echo ""
echo "Directory structure:"
echo " docker-compose.local.yml - Docker Compose configuration"
echo " .env - Environment variables (generated secrets)"
echo " .env.example - Example template (for reference)"
echo " data/ - Application data (will be created on first run)"
echo " postgres_data/ - PostgreSQL data"
echo " redis_data/ - Redis data"
echo ""
echo "Next steps:"
echo " 1. (Optional) Edit .env to customize configuration"
echo " 2. Start services:"
echo " docker-compose -f docker-compose.local.yml up -d"
echo ""
echo " 3. View logs:"
echo " docker-compose -f docker-compose.local.yml logs -f sub2api"
echo ""
echo " 4. Access Web UI:"
echo " http://localhost:8080"
echo ""
print_info "If admin password is not set in .env, it will be auto-generated."
print_info "Check logs for the generated admin password on first startup."
echo ""
}
# Run main function
main "$@"
